public class AuditProfilePanel
The Audit and Metrics profile panel. This panel allows a user to view, create, edit, and delete audit and metrics profiles. A profile is a set of properties for all the rules or all the metrics registered with Audit. Profiles are saved in the IDE system directory and are known to users by their simple name.
This panel has a profile combobox and Save As and Delete buttons at the top. The combobox allows the user to select which profile to view or modify. Once the user modifies a profile, the combobox shows blank as the profile name, until the modifications are saved or deleted using the Save As or Delete buttons.
The contents of the selected profile are shown below the combobox: the rules or metrics are shown in a tree; the editable properties and an explanation of the selected rule or metric are shown in an adjoining property sheet and text area. The main players in keeping these views current are the following:
The profile repository maintains Profile instances corresponding to the saved profiles. This panel lets the repository be the keeper of those instances and holds only one Profile instance itself:
When the combo box selection changes, the profile panel resets the profile in the profile model to (a copy of) the selected profile. The profile model doesn't actually hold any objects from a profile, but holds names instead and retrieves categories, rules, and metrics from the current profile only as needed. This means that the tree nodes do not change when the profile changes; however, the tree must be repainted (because enabled properties might have changed) and the text area and property inspector must be reset (because they depend on the actual objects in the profile, not the names in the profile model).
When the tree selection changes, the profile panel resets the text of the text area and the object edited by the property inspector, and makes itself a listener to the edited object (removing itself as a listener to the previously edited object).
When a property changes, the profile panel clears the profile name and ensures that the unnamed profile is selected in the repository model.
When the profile panel is hidden, it saves the unnamed profile to be restored when the panel is next shown.

)Since a Navigable wraps a Traversable, and a Traversable wraps a Component, the priority order for determining the help ID is based on giving the outer-most wrapper the opportunity to override. The Navigable container has the lowest priority because containers such as MDDPanel, TabbedPanel, and FSMWizard don't normally have a help topic ID of their own, since help topics tend to be on a per page basis.
For most cases the recommended approach is to have the Traversable specify the help ID. However, when the same Traversable can be used in different contexts, then specifying or overriding the help ID from the MetaTraversable could be better, especially if that avoids the need for conditional logic in Traversable.getHelpID(). If no dynamic behavior is needed in determining the help ID, then the implementation can probably just subclass DefaultTraversablePanel
and call the DefaultTraversablePanel.setHelpID(String)
method from the subclass constructor.
The getHelpID() method is called only when the user requests help, so the actual help ID may be determined dynamically (e.g. return a different ID depending on the state of the UI).
